WebIt's possible to multi-class, meaning you'd use the hit dice of the relevant classes you've taken levels in when determining hit points. As a pure barbarian, with no levels in other classes, you would roll a 1d12 upon leveling up, and add your constitution modifier to the result, then add that to your initial hit points. WebYour hit points are determined by your Hit Dice (short for Hit Point Dice). At 1st level, your character has 1 Hit Die, and the die type is determined by your class. You start with hit points equal to the highest roll of that die, as indicated in your class description. (You also add your Constitution modifier, which you’ll determine in step 3.) Web1 nov 2024 · A player may spend 1 or more Hit Dice. For each spent, they roll a die (class specific) and add their Constitution modifier to the result (of each roll). A play may spend 1 Hit Die at a time or more than 1 at a time. A player’s total amount of Hit Dice is equal to their character level. Some Hit Dice are regained after finishing a long rest.
